i was looking at my taskmanager screen while playing a game to see what is wrong with the problem i keep having,
i saw that my cpu that usually runs at 4.04 ghz but then it drops down to 1.32 ghz mid game .
why does this happen and how do i fix it?
CPU: amd FX 8350
GPU: Gtx 1060 6gb
MB: MSI 970A-G43 (MS-7693)
PSU: 650 WATTS
RAM: 16GB
when at 5% it is at 40 Degrees celcius

It could be its temperature. https://www.msi.com/page/afterburner can show you. Your idle temperature suggests everything is okay but without the top end we can only assume which is wrong.

you can manually change the CPUs min power state. Right click start, power options, change plan settings, advanced power options, min power state. Change from 5% to 100%.

It could be normal. If there's not much for the CPU to do it will throttle back.

You can download https://www.techpowerup.com/download/techpowerup-throttlestop/ and avoid that.

Unfortunately I can't tell you the why. I can only offer band-aids.
